Assessing Claim Feasibility

Evaluating the feasibility of your medical malpractice claim is a critical first step. An experienced Atlanta medical malpractice lawyer will carefully review the details of your case to determine its viability. They’ll assess several key factors:

  1. Negligence: Did the healthcare provider’s actions or inactions deviate from the accepted standard of care? Your lawyer will examine medical records and consult expert witnesses to establish negligence.
  2. Causation: Was the provider’s negligence the direct cause of your injuries or worsened condition? This causal link must be clearly demonstrated.
  3. Damages: Have you suffered quantifiable economic and non-economic damages, such as medical expenses, lost wages, and pain and suffering? Substantial damages are essential for a successful claim.

If your case meets these criteria, your lawyer will advise you on the best course of action.

Determining Negligence Validity

Establishing negligence is the cornerstone of a successful medical malpractice claim. Your Atlanta medical malpractice lawyer will thoroughly examine the details of your case to determine if the healthcare provider’s actions or inactions breached the standard of care. This involves gathering and analyzing relevant medical records, expert witness testimonies, and any other supporting evidence.

Your lawyer will assess whether the provider failed to exercise the level of care that a reasonably prudent healthcare professional would have provided in the same or similar circumstances. They’ll also evaluate if this breach directly caused your injuries or worsened your condition.

Proving negligence can be complex, so your lawyer will work diligently to build a strong case and validate the merits of your claim. Gathering and Analyzing Evidence

To successfully build a medical malpractice case, you’ll need to gather and analyze an extensive amount of evidence. This includes medical records, expert witness testimony, and any other relevant documentation that can help establish negligence and prove the extent of your damages.

The key steps in gathering and analyzing evidence are:

  1. Obtaining thorough medical records: You’ll need to request and review all medical records related to the alleged malpractice, including hospital charts, laboratory tests, diagnostic imaging, and any other relevant documentation.
  2. Consulting with medical experts: Partnering with qualified medical experts who can review the evidence and provide an objective assessment of the standard of care and any deviations from it’s essential.
  3. Documenting the impact on your life: Gather evidence of the physical, emotional, and financial toll the malpractice has taken on you, such as medical bills, lost wages, and the effect on your quality of life.

Preparing for Court Proceedings

If your negotiations with the insurance company are unsuccessful, you’ll need to prepare for the possibility of taking your medical malpractice case to court. Your Atlanta medical malpractice lawyer will guide you through the court proceedings, making sure you’re fully prepared.

Here are three key steps to prepare for court:

  1. Gather all relevant evidence: Your lawyer will work with you to collect medical records, expert witness testimonies, and any other documentation that supports your case. This evidence will be important in proving medical negligence.
  2. Prepare your testimony: You’ll likely be required to testify in court, so your lawyer will help you practice your account of the events and make sure you’re confident and composed when answering questions.
  3. Understand the legal process: Your lawyer will explain the court procedures, timelines, and your role throughout the proceedings, so you know what to expect and can focus on presenting your case effectively.

Maximizing Claim Value

Maximizing your medical malpractice claim’s value requires a strategic approach. It’s not just about proving liability; it’s about quantifying the full extent of your damages and presenting a compelling case to the insurance company or jury.

Here are three key steps to maximize your claim’s value:

  1. Thoroughly document your losses. This includes not only your medical expenses but also lost wages, future earning potential, and the impact on your quality of life. Gather all relevant records and work with expert witnesses to substantiate these damages.
  2. Highlight the severity of your injuries. The more severe and life-altering your injuries, the higher the potential compensation. Work with your lawyer to effectively convey the physical, emotional, and psychological toll of the medical malpractice.
  3. Negotiate assertively. Your lawyer will use their expertise to negotiate with the insurance company and, if necessary, prepare a strong case for trial. Their negotiation skills can make a significant difference in the final settlement amount.
